RICH BOY, “Throw Some D’s,” from Product of the Hustle (Interscope): The rugged Alabamian MC gets a bouncy assist from burgeoning superproducer/former Jim Crow member Polow da Don. Sean Fennessey, Associate Music Editor

PROJECT PAT, “Relax and Take Notes,” from Ridin’ High (Bad Boy): An underappreciated banger from Orange Mound’s finest—menacing beat, Biggie Smalls sample, and one of Ball’s best verses in his storied career: “M-E-M-P-H-I-S / I’ma rep this here till I walk up on death.” Benjamin Meadows-Ingram, Senior Editor
NOEL ZANCANELLA, FEAT. BAATIN, “Could It Be?” from Noel Zancanella, Featuring Baatin (Sonom): A hypnotizing hip hop beat for a hectic day is hard to come by, and Zancanella, who just may be our next Pete Rock, delivers. Linda Hobbs, Reporter

JOJO, “The Way You Do Me,” from The High Road (DaFamily/ Blackground/Universal): She’s only 15, but with a little help from Swizz Beatz, JoJo’s about to be all up in the club. Chris Yuscavage, Reporter
